Every now and then, the Acrobat Reader simply stops printing.

I open some PDF document, select File - Print, select the printer I want, and hit the "Print" button. After pressing the button, the "Print" screens disappear and nothing more happens.

The "Progress" popup window that normally is displayed immediately after clicking the print button is not even displayed, and no document is placed in the printer's print queue. I seems that the the program simply aborts the printing. No error is produced.

I realized that the problem seems to occur after trying to print a subset of pages from some document. And when it happens, it does for good. No printing works anymore, even if I try to print the whole document, or even other documents I was able to print before.

Additional info:

- Windows 10 (version 1607 - 10.0.14393), 64 bits, connected with home WiFi (also happens on different computers).

- Printer: Epson L395 Series, connected through WiFi (same problem occurs with another printer, from HP).

- I can print from other programs. Office, notepad, even the printer config test page works.

- Using Acrobat Reader DC (version 17.12.20098.240878).

As you are experiencing the issue while printing PDF from the Adobe Acrobat Reader application, try once to repair the application.

To repair, launch the application and go to Help menu.

Then select Repair Installation from the drop-down menu.

Also, try the troubleshooting steps provided here Troubleshoot PDF printing in Acrobat and Reader if the repair function does not help.

Let us know how it goes.

If the issue still persists, try to recreate the preferences for the application.

You may refer the steps provided here: How to reset Acrobat Preference settings to default.
